How they compare

ALECSO: Member Countries currently reports 0.8116 GPIA against 0.7624 GPIA in Costa Rica, a difference of 0.0492 GPIA.

That makes ALECSO: Member Countries's figure about 1.1 times Costa Rica's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 13 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Costa Rica ahead.

ALECSO: Member Countries ranks 94th and Costa Rica ranks 94th of 214 groups.

Across the 2 decades both report, ALECSO: Member Countries averaged higher in 1 and Costa Rica in 1.
